If the Colts want to win in Jacksonville for the first time since 2014, they will have to do so without running back Jonathan Taylor.

According to several reporters, head coach Shane Steichen announced in his Friday press conference that Taylor will not play in the Week 5 game against the Jaguars.

Taylor has an ankle injury and did not practice this week. So far this season, Taylor has run for 349 yards, scored four touchdowns, and caught six passes for 77 yards.

Trey Sermon is expected to start in place of Taylor.

Quarterback Anthony Richardson’s situation is also uncertain as he has an oblique injury. Steichen mentioned that Richardson was limited in practice throughout the week. While he did not confirm Richardson’s game status, it seems likely that he will be listed as questionable.

If Richardson cannot play, Joe Flacco would likely start.

Steichen also stated that defensive end Kwity Paye (quad) and cornerback Kenny Moore (hip) will not play.

Indianapolis will release its full injury report with game statuses later on Friday.
